20155314 《信息安全系统设计基础》课程总结
20155314 《信息安全系统设计基础》课程总结
每周作业链接汇总
- 2017-2018-1 20155314 《信息安全系统设计基础》第1周学习总结:熟悉Linux系统下的开发环境掌握静态库和动态库的生成与调用方法
- 2017-2018-1 20155314 《信息安全系统设计基础》第3周学习总结:深入学习计算机算术运算的特性,进一步理解“信息=位+上下文”
- 2017-2018-1 20155314 《信息安全系统设计基础》第4周学习总结:掌握系统编程错误处理的方式,掌握Unix/Linux系统级I/O,掌握I/O重定向的方法
- 2017-2018-1 20155314 《信息安全系统设计基础》第5周学习总结:掌握X86汇编基础,学会阅读(反)汇编代码
- 2017-2018-1 20155314 《信息安全系统设计基础》第7周学习总结:了解处理器的体系结构,学习多线程的概念
- 2017-2018-1 20155314 《信息安全系统设计基础》第9周学习总结:了解常见的存储技术(RAM、ROM、磁盘、固态硬盘等),理解缓存思想、高速缓存的原理和应用等
- 2017-2018-1 20155314 《信息安全系统设计基础》第11周学习总结:理解虚拟存储器的概念和作用,掌握动态存储器分配的方法,了解C语言中与存储器有关的错误
- 2017-2018-1 20155314 《信息安全系统设计基础》第13周学习总结:找出全书我认为最重要的一章,并深入重新学习
- 2017-2018-1 20155314 《信息安全系统设计基础》第14周学习总结:找出全书我认为学得最差的一章,并深入重新学习
- 课后实践项目:
- 课后实践之mybash:使用fork(),exec(),wait()实现mybash
- 课后实践之mybash:使用fork(),exec(),wait()实现mybash
实验报告链接汇总
- 2017-2018-1 20155314《信息安全系统设计基础》实验一 开发环境的熟悉:交叉编译、目标机宿主机连通、目标机运行程序、目标机模块分解
- 2017-2018-1 20155314《信息安全系统设计基础》实验二 固件程序设计:固件程序设计MDK、LED、UART、国密算法SM1
- 2017-2018-1 20155314《信息安全系统设计基础》实验三 并发程序:实现多线程传送文本文件的客户端和服务器
- 2017-2018-1 20155314《信息安全系统设计基础》实验四 外设驱动程序设计:学习Linux设备驱动编程
- 2017-2018-1 20155314《信息安全系统设计基础》实验五 通讯协议设计:Linux下OpenSSL的简单使用、混合密码系统的编写
代码托管链接和二维码
- 代码量汇总提交statistics.sh的支持截图,说明本学期的代码量目标达到没有?
- 代码驱动的学习做到没有?
- 加点代码,改点代码是理解的最好方式,参考编程的智慧,谈谈你的心得
- 实践上有什么经验教训
整体评价一下第1周作业中自己提出的问题是不是抓住了学习重点
回答一下第1周作业中自己提出的问题
你有什么项目被加分,谈谈你的经验
-
优秀作业(给出链接和二维码)
-
总结(给出链接和二维码)
-
项目(给出链接和二维码)
-
教程(给出链接和二维码)
-
竞赛
- 参加全国密码技术竞赛并成功进入复赛,但遗憾的是没能进决赛,也没得到加分(哭)
- 参加全国密码技术竞赛并成功进入复赛,但遗憾的是没能进决赛,也没得到加分(哭)
你有什么项目被扣分,谈谈你的教训
- 无
课程收获与不足
- 自己的收获(投入,效率,效果等)
- 自己需要改进的地方
- 如果有结对,写一下你提供的帮助或接受了什么帮助,并对老师提供参考建议
给开学初的你和学弟学妹们的学习建议
- 如果重新学习这门课,怎么做才可以学的更好
- 基础最重要!一定要抽时间多学学计算机基础知识,咱们系并没有像二系那样开设《计算机组成原理》课,但我认为还是很有必要去学学的!这些基本知识不掌握的话学底层相关知识会比较费劲,容易产生畏难情绪
- 和这学期的另一门必修课《操作系统》联系起来学会收获更大、体会更深
问卷调查
- 你平均每周投入到本课程多长时间?
- 平均每周8~14小时
- 每周的学习效率有提高吗?
- 感觉自己学习效率适中,有待提高
- 学习效果自己满意吗?
- 总体上比较满意,但中间有一段时间稍有放松,不太满意
- 课程结束后会继续一周至少一篇博客吗?(如果能做到,毕业时我把你的博客给你集结成一本书送给你作纪念)
- 目前已经养成了学到知识、总结经验就写博客的习惯,但不会给自己限制死了一周至少一篇的量,看自己的学习情况吧
- 你觉得这门课老师应该继续做哪一件事情?
- 课堂讲授、考核与实践相结合的教学方式
- 你觉得这门课老师应该停止做哪一件事情?
- 往码云上上传代码,对大多数学生来说已经沦为形式毫无意义
- 你觉得这门课老师应该开始做什么新的事情?
- 抽出点课时给同学们补补计算机专业基础知识如计算机组成原理等(比如刘念老师的《网络安全编程》课就给大家补了计算机网络相关知识),个人感觉这门课还是有一定高度和深度的,对于基础薄弱的同学来说还是会感到困难和吃力的